From the Paper:
"The book Dearest Friend by Lynne Withey started her professional career as an Assistant Director in a press in 1986 and later became an Associate Director in 1993, having the task for strategic planning along with general operations. Furthermore, she has played a very important part in shaping not only editorial programs but also assisted in obtaining books in music, history, Asian and Middle Eastern studies, and public health and even launched the Press's electronic publishing program.
Moreover, she is the writer of four books that also include the newly reissued Dearest Friend, A Life of Abigail Adams, and Voyages of Discovery: Captain Cook and British Exploration of the Pacific. As for her qualification, she is a graduate of Smith College in Northampton, Massachusetts, and majored in American Studies and from the University of California, Berkeley she later received a Ph.D. in history. From 1974 till the year 1979 at the University of Iowa, she was an assistant professor of history as well as at Boston University she was a visiting assistant professor from the year 1977 till 1978."
